Abstract

This study on the impact of promotion of the marketing of new services with particular note on Globa-com Plc Enugu was carried out some of the following objective.



1. To determine the Impact of promotional strategies in Creating consumers awareness of Globa –Com



2. To determine the Impact of promotional strategies on customers patronage of Globa-Com in Enugu Metropolis. For additional information extensive literature review was conducted, researcher reviewed text books, journals magazines and News papers that are related to this study. In order o achieve thus objective three set if questionnaire were prepare and administered to a population comparison staff/management distributors and customers of Globa-Com Plc within Enugu Metropolis. The sample size of the study was determined using Topman’s formula to determine the sample size for customers, while censuses were used or the relevant staff management.



The data collected were presented on statistical table, analyzed and interpreted.



The hypothesis were tested using chi-square based on the analysis he following finding were made that the personal selling strategy has much impact on customers disposition and patronage. That Globa-com Plc have not fully designed an optimal combinations of promo-tools to enhance their performances.



The researcher wants the coverage of GSM facilities to extent to more areas, particularly the towns and village to engender wider communication in the country.



The researcher recommended that the capacity of Globa-Com should be up grade urgently to enable it support efficient service of GSM in Nigeria.

1.1 BACKGROUND OF THE STUDY



Establishment of business including communication services requires that the firms make key decision. These decision affects the total marketing programmes of the firm, simple put the marketing strategy. However one vital area of such decision which demands proper attention is the communication strategy.



Communication industry must initiate promotional polices and programmes to inform, persuade and educate its target audience of the existence of the organization and their products.



Although creation of demand of a firm product may be the ultimate objectives of a company’s marketing promotion, this objective is never achieved at one full swoop. The firm must put in place a set of activities aimed at stimulating demand for their products.



This may involve determining the optional combinations of the promotional Mix, advertising sales promotions, personal selling, publicity, public relation Direct marketing and packaging to achieve its promotional objectives. This optional lend is a function of the promotional resources nature of the product, just to mention but a few.



Adirika, Ebue, and Nnolim (1996: 35) see promotion as the component used by the organization to inform, educate and persuade the market regarding the company’s offerings. Advertising personal selling, sales promotion, publicity and public relations are the major variables of promotion.



Promotion is a vital ingredient of survival and development, without adequate promotion products may not sell, when they their continuity is in doubt. The art and science of marketing promotion, which comprises advertising personal selling sales promotion, public relations and direct marketing is often associated with glamour and flamboyance. Infact most of the budget of some companies is spent on promotions because of the need of survive in the competitive marketing environment.



Edoga and Ani (2000:243) noted that marketing success does not, just depend on good product, good price and efficient distribution. It is also vital that organization communicates its, so offerings to that advertising, personal selling sale promotions public relations, publicity and direct marketing can be used to inform prospective buyers about the benefit of their products persuade then to try and remind them later about the benefits they will desire by using the product.



Modern marketing companies are increasingly recognizing the value of an effective communication and promotion programme for their entire public including G.S.M Global communication.



Ebue noted that modern marketing does not shop at developing a good product, pricing it attractively and making it really available to target customers. The company must communicate to its target audience, tell good stories, disseminate information about the products existence, feature terms and benefits to the target market.



Coppo. J. 91992: 201) confirms that the promotional tools serve as supreme vehicles in competition and provide the only way a market nicher can, hope to penetrate on established market. He went further to state hat for a company to excel above others in the competitive market such a company must value the importance of promotion.
